Cmd/Ctrl + K with a project open and the command palette appears. One input field covers finding files, making them, and changing settings. The shortcut binds only inside a project, so it does nothing on the home screen.
When you have typed nothing
The empty palette is divided into a few blocks. At the top, Recently used carries up to four rows you have picked often from this palette. Below that come Suggestions · Navigate · General in that order. Suggestions holds the things tied to the file you are looking at, so it appears only while a file is open. Rows that carry the file name, such as Set Label for âChapter 1 draftâ and Open Notes for âChapter 1 draftâ, come up alongside fixed-name rows such as Move ToâŠ, Duplicate, and Move to Trash. Navigate holds Go to Project Home, Go to Graph View, Go to Tasks, and Go to Notes. General holds Settings, the theme you are not using at the moment (Light Mode or Dark Mode), System Theme, Show getting-started checklist, Open Log Folder, and Hanja Conversion. Only the row for the theme you are using drops out; the other theme rows stay.Once you start typing
Results shows files whose titles match right away. The search that digs into body text arrives a beat later and attaches to the bottom of the list in per-type groups such as Documents, Sheets, and Plot Cards. Create rises to the top only when you say to create something. Typecreate draft and five rows appear, from Create âdraftâ as Document through sheet, plotboard, canvas, and folder. Point at a type, as in new document draft, and only that one row is left. When you type a bare word, the create rows drop below the search results.
The Settings group catches values too, so typing dark produces a row that applies on the spot. If you are writing in Korean, Convert ââŠâ to Hanja always tags along as well.
Narrowing and previewing
PressTab and what you have typed hardens into a chip in the input field, and what you type next is searched only within it. Clear the chips all at once with Esc, or one at a time with Backspace in an empty input field.
Put the cursor on a document, sheet, task, note, or plot card row in the per-type groups below and its contents preview on the right. Open page takes you straight in. It does not appear when the window is narrow.
